Louise Anne Bloom (born 7 April 1964) is a Liberal Democrat politician. She was a founder member of the London Assembly, being elected as a list member representing the whole of Greater London. She resigned her seat for family reasons on 18 February 2002 and was replaced by Mike Tuffrey.
Louise Bloom was a member of Eastleigh Borough Council from 2002 to 2017, and a cabinet member for that authority.
